In today's competitive marketplace, building strong supplier networks is vital for B2B success. Effective supplier relationships can enhance product offerings and streamline operations, ultimately driving business growth.
Strong relationships with suppliers foster collaboration, innovation, and trust. Suppliers who feel valued are more likely to prioritize your business, ensuring timely deliveries and favorable pricing. Building these relationships requires ongoing communication and mutual respect.
1. **Prioritize Communication**: Regular, transparent communication with suppliers helps address issues promptly and builds trust. Consider implementing tools that facilitate open dialogue between teams.
2. **Invest in Long-term Partnerships**: Rather than seeking the lowest-cost suppliers, focus on building long-term relationships that bring value. Consider the total cost of ownership and the potential for collaboration.
3. **Leverage Technology**: Utilize technology to manage supplier relationships efficiently. Supplier management software can streamline communication, monitor performance, and provide valuable insights.
4. **Conduct Regular Evaluations**: Routinely assess supplier performance to ensure they meet your standards. This practice allows businesses to address issues proactively and identify opportunities for improvement.
5. **Engage in Joint Initiatives**: Collaborating with suppliers on joint projects or initiatives can strengthen relationships and foster innovation. Consider co-developing new products or sharing best practices.
